Euro-MP Backs Local Publicans' Right to Buy

February 1, 2001 12:00 AM

Diana Wallis, Lib Dem Euro-MP for Yorkshire and the Humber, has given her backing to a campaign by Whitbread Partnerships Publicans for the right to buy their pubs should Whitbread put their 3000 outlets up for sale.

Diana has been drawn into the campaign after being approached by one of the campaign leaders, local publican the "Coach and Horses" in Chapel Town, Sheffield.

Writing to Mario Monti, European Competition Commissioner, Diana Wallis is asking him to carefully monitor any future en bloc sale of the pubs for possible anti-competitive effects on the market.

Many of these Publicans entered into the leasing arrangements with the Whitbread Pub Partnership on the understanding - conveyed by the name and promotional material - that they had some form of 'partnership' agreement.

Says Diana Wallis,

"Not unreasonably, they therefore assumed from the prominent use of the word partnership, that that was indeed what they had. In such circumstances as have now arisen, they believe that at the very least, they should be given first refusal before any sale."

Diana Wallis is keen to ensure fair play for these publicans.

"They have invested time, effort and large sums of money into their businesses on the basis of what may have been a misrepresentation at the time of purchase. And let us not forget the implications for consumer choice of such an en bloc sale.

"Clearly we have to keep a watchful eye on this, ensuring both that publicans are treated fairly and any anti-competitive effect threatening consumer choice are avoided.

"Whitbread even stands accused by one of its former chairman who says they are refusing to give publicans first rights of refusal on their leases. I would hope they will review their position and think very carefully about how these assets are dealt with."
